Output 81d6dcfbe66171bdea5f532e0f2715ff6feb2ffa3eb7c4470f1196af8f6f6812:0

value
6967084985693
script pubkey
OP_0 OP_PUSHBYTES_20 6802497fe5b226ddce4b8ea937f359fc571cc3da
address
tb1qdqpyjll9kgndmnjt365n0u6el3t3es76kmxka9
transaction
81d6dcfbe66171bdea5f532e0f2715ff6feb2ffa3eb7c4470f1196af8f6f6812
confirmations
190448
spent
true